<div> <h2>Ha Noi vs Viettel: Derby Data Points Suggest Tight, Low-Scoring Tilt</h2> <p>The V.League 1 returns to the capital with a marquee derby as Ha Noi host Viettel. It’s early in the season, but momentum, matchup traits, and last week’s cup meeting (a 1-0 Viettel win) give this tie a distinct shape: robust visitors, late-sparking hosts, and a scoreboard likely to be restrained.</p> <h3>Form and Momentum</h3> <p>Viettel’s start has been quietly authoritative: unbeaten in three, two straight wins, six scored and just one conceded. They’ve scored first in every league match, reflecting a proactive start and effective set of patterns in build-up and transition. Ha Noi, by contrast, are still hunting their first win (D1 L2) and carry a 0.33 points-per-game rate. Their away defeats were open and chaotic, but the sole home match finished 0-0 – a snapshot of attacking rust and defensive stability inside My Dinh.</p> <h3>Venue Split: What Changes at My Dinh?</h3> <p>Ha Noi’s only home league game ended 0-0; they failed to score, but also kept a clean sheet. Viettel’s sole away match finished 1-1: they struck in the third minute but could not defend the lead. Sample sizes are tiny, yet the combination hints at early initiative from Viettel and a cagey, low-event baseline at Ha Noi’s ground.</p> <h3>Tactical Threads and Key Players</h3> <p>Expect Viettel to lean into their compact 4-2-3-1/4-4-2 hybrid, with Nguyen Hoang Duc orchestrating and new Brazilian forward Amarildo offering directness and presence between the posts. Their defensive numbers (two clean sheets already) reflect well-drilled staggering between the lines and protection of the box. Ha Noi’s creativity runs through the wiles of Van Quyet, with Joao Pedro adding physicality up top. But their chance creation has skewed late; all three league goals have arrived between minutes 76-90, a trend consistent with chasing states and risk-on substitutions.</p> <h3>Game State and Timing: Why the Second Half Matters</h3> <p>Goal timing is a critical angle. Ha Noi average conceding first around the 16th minute, while Viettel’s average minute for the first goal is 27. That supports the pattern of early Viettel pressure. After the break, both teams’ matches tilt toward more goals: Viettel have scored two of their six in the final quarter-hour; Ha Noi’s entire season tally has come after minute 75.
